Configure Wallboard View 6 (Reason Code Rows)

Introduction

This view is also known as Reason Code View.

Configure

  1. Open the config.xml file, which is located in the Anywhere365 “InFlight WallBoard\I01” folder

  2. The value for the DefaultView

    6 = Rows

  3. Make sure the General Settings are as in the example below

    Copy
    XML
     <!-- General Settings -->
    <DefaultView value="6" enabled="true"></DefaultView>
    <!-- 1 Normal, 2 Custom (Grid), 3 Multiple, 4 InboundOnly, 5 StatisticsView, 6 Reason Code -->
    <MultipleUCCGroup value="-1" enabled="true" />
    <!-- -1 == GroupView, 0 == group 0, 1 == group 1, 2 == group 2, 12 == group 12, etc-->
    <LogLevel value="All" enabled="true" />
    <!-- All, Critical, Error, Warning, Information, Verbose -->
    <LowestSkillValue value="1" enabled="true" />
    <Language value="en" enabled="true"></Language>
    <!-- End General Settings -->
  4. Next make sure the "Normal View Settings" are correct. (Entered during installation)

    Copy
    XML
    <!-- Normal View Settings -->
    <DashboardServer version="1.5" name="ucc-" value="http(s)://<FQDN>/DashboardService" SLA1Label="20 sec" SLA2Label="2 min" SLA1="20" SLA2="120"></DashboardServer>
    <Credentials username="" password="" />
    <!-- End Normal View Settings -->

    2. value = URL to dashboard service of the UCC.

    3. SLA1Label = Text value which is shown in the SLA bar's first item.

    4. SLA2Label = Text value which is shown in the SLA bar's second and third item.

    5. SLA1 = Number of seconds which is used in the SLA bar's first item and SLA percentage.

    6. SLA2 = Number of seconds which is used in the SLA bar's second and third item.

    7. Credentials = Automatically entered when connection to a secure dashboard.

  5. Next make sure the "ReasonCode" Settings are correct.

    Copy
    XML
    <ReasonCodes enabled="true" value="InACall;Discharge;Administration;Lunch/Dinner;*" />
    <DetermineFirstReasonCodeInCall enabled="true" value="true"/>
    <DetermineSecondReasonCodeDischarg enabled="true" value="true" />
    <ShowAgentTotalNumberCallsPerDay enabled="false" value="true" />
    1. ReasonCodes = Names of the reasoncodes.

      Note: Use * as last reason code when more then 5 reason codes need to be used.
    2. DetermineFirstReasonCodeInCall = Use first row / columns for status "InCall"

    3. DetermineSecondReasonCodeDischarg= Use second row / columns for "Discharge"

    4. ShowAgentTotalNumberCallsPerDay = True (show CallToday) / False (show Talk Time + Discharge Duration)

  6. Save the file

  7. Now the Reason Code View is applied for the Wallboard.
